How Solar Panels Work

Solar panels convert sunlight into electricity through a process called the photovoltaic effect. When sunlight hits the solar cells in the panels, it excites electrons, creating an electric current. This current is then converted into usable electricity for your home or business.

The efficiency of solar panels varies, typically ranging from 15% to 22%. Higher efficiency panels generate more electricity from the same amount of sunlight, which can significantly affect the number of panels you need.

Benefits of Solar Panels

Investing in solar panels comes with a host of benefits:

  • Cost Savings: Reduce your electricity bills significantly over time.
  • Environmental Impact: Decrease your carbon footprint and contribute to a cleaner planet.
  • Energy Independence: Generate your own electricity and reduce reliance on the grid.
  • Increased Property Value: Homes with solar installations often have higher resale values.

Challenges and Limitations

While solar energy is a fantastic option, it does come with its own set of challenges:

  • Initial Costs: The upfront investment can be significant, although incentives and financing options are available.
  • Weather Dependency: Solar panels are less effective on cloudy days and during winter months.
  • Space Requirements: Depending on your energy needs, you may require a substantial roof area for installation.
  • Maintenance: While generally low, solar panels do require occasional cleaning and inspections.

Myth Debunked: Solar Panels Only Work in Sunny Climates

A common misconception is that solar panels are ineffective in cloudy or rainy areas. While it’s true that solar panels generate more electricity in direct sunlight, they can still produce energy on overcast days. In fact, many regions with less sunshine have successfully adopted solar energy solutions.
